CRJU 7301 - Pro-seminar


Three credit hours.

A critical examination of the theoretical, methodological, and policy issues in criminal justice and criminology. Explores organized knowledge about enduring theoretical and policy questions concerning crime and justice; examines the theoretical foundations of crime control, the relationship between criminal justice agencies, and the relationship between the criminal justice system and its social, political, and economic environments. Also provides students with an overview of criminal justice in higher education and requirements of a graduate education.
